Position Summary: 

Phoenix Heart is looking for an experienced Nurse Practitioner who can deliver medical care within a hospital setting with the specialty of cardiology and heart failure to a wide variety of patients. The NP will be responsible for caring for patients, maintaining accurate and current patient records in the hospitals. The successful candidate will work as a team with our physicians and will assist in delivering premium care to each and every patient.

Responsibilities: 

  • Performing physical exams and patient observations.
  • Recording patients' medical histories and symptoms.
  • Creating patient care plans and contributing to existing ones.
  • Ordering, administering, and analyzing diagnostic tests.
  • Monitoring and operating medical equipment.
  • Diagnosing health issues.
  • Administering medicine and other treatments.
  • Detecting changes in patients' health and modifying treatment plans, as needed.
  • Consulting with healthcare professionals and families.
  • Training patients and their families to manage and prevent illness and injury.
